I've stepped out of my comfort zone a little bit for this one and made an altered heart shaped box for my daughter Iona.  Bugaboo very kindly gave the DT some digis to work with so I chose Cheerleader Girl as Iona does Cheerleading as well as other types of dance.  I thought the box would be ideal for holding her growing collection of cheer bows!




I bought a plain box from Hobbycraft then gave it 2 coats of Artiste acrylic paint inside and out.  I then added strips of patterned paper to the sides and a heart shaped piece to the top.  The paper on the top is by Stampin' Up, the other I picked up as a single sheet in my local craft shop but I don't know the brand.  I coloured the image with Promarkers and added some Stardust Stickles to the pom poms.  I die cut the image into a heart shape using an X-cut die then edged it with some spotty organza ribbon which I folded into pleats as I went along.  The box is finished off with some sequin braid along the edge of the lid and some glitter dome stickers.

So, Q is for Quilt.  I've made a patchwork background kind of in the style of a quilt.


I've used my MME Merry papers again cut into swatches with a Spellbinders nestie die and added some faux stitching with a Micron pen.  The image is a Sylvia Zet Wee Stamps topper from Hobby House and it's mounted on a Spellbinders lacey circle mat.  The sentiment is by LOTV and I've added a ribbon bow and some pearls to finish.

I've coloured Tilda with Promarkers to match the unidentified but rather yummy paper that was in a bag of stash one of my crafty friends passed on to me.  I've gone a but mad with the die cutting on this one and used a Memory Box Frostyville Border and corner die as well as X-cut scalloped circles and Spellbinders Lacey Circle dies.  The sentiment set is by Paula Pascual and I've used Tim Holtz distress ink to stamp it for a change.  The only other additions are a Dovecraft doiley, spotty organza ribbon and some pearls.
